“529 C.E. — Justinian I, Corpus Juris Civilis: Codex Justinianus, 10.73.2”
It is settled that when any doubt arises with reference to the purity of the solidi paid, the dispute shall be decided by the officer styled zygostat in Greek, who is appointed in each city, and who shall render his decision to the best of his ability and information.
